What can I expect on my first appointment?


hands onOn your first visit a full and strictly confidential medical history will be taken. This will include questions about your general health and lifestyle as well as the problem for which you are seeking treatment.

An osteopathic examination and postural assessment will be carried out. For this you will be asked to remove your outer clothes so that your overall posture and spine can be assessed and areas of tenderness, stiffness or strain identified. Please wear underwear that you are comfortable in, or bring a pair of shorts if you prefer. Gowns are available on request. You may be asked to perform some simple movements.

The in-depth medical history is to ensure that your complaint is suitable for osteopathic treatment. Having made a diagnosis, your osteopath will discuss this with you before moving on to treatment. Your treatment plan may include self-help strategies for pain relief as well as stretching and strengthening exercises if appropriate.
